Evolution of spin wave excitations of Mn3Sn in different magnetic ordered phases
Abstract: Mn3Sn has very complex magnetic ordered phase, a clear magnetic phase transition happens at T=~280K accompanied by the vanishing of AHE.For our Mn3Sn crystal grown by flux method, by using polarised neutron diffraction, we found a magnetic reflection splitting below that usually known phase transition temperature T=280K indicating the existence of a new incommensurate magnetic ordered phase in Mn3Sn.So we would like to apply 4 days neutron beamtime at time of flight spectrometer Merlin to re-investigate the evolution of spin waves in these different magnetic ordered phases for better understanding of the exchange interactions and the influence of different magnetic ordered phase on this Weyl system.
